What’s Amino?

Amino is a social network that can be downloaded on a Chromebook.
Amino is a social network at its core.

Amino is a social network developed by Narvii Inc. It’s a popular app that’s rated 4.7/5 stars on iOS and similarly on Google Play at the time of this writing.

Amino lets you chat with people who have similar interests.

The app calls them “Communities” and you can choose and join from a wide variety of them.

From a quick glance at their homepage, I saw communities for movies, games, TV shows, sports, art, music, and more. You can join communities that you’re interested in and then chat with people within that group.

Amino also has public and private chat options, along with other basic social network functions such as posting threads, videos, pictures, polls, real-time chats, emojis, likes, wikis, sharing, and more. It’s free to sign up and free to use with in-app purchases.

Download Amino from the Play Store

You can download the official Amino app on your Chromebook through the Play Store.
Amino is readily available on the Play Store.

You can download and install the Amino app from Google Play.

Newer Chromebooks have the Play Store already “built-in” by default.

So that means you can just literally head on over to the store, search for the app, and then download it. It should run on your Chromebook just fine, but you can expect some bugs and glitches here and there.

Chrome OS has the ability to download and run Android apps on your Chromebook, but the feature is new. Thus, it doesn’t work perfectly and you should expect some problems here and there.

Regardless, here’s how to download Amino on your Chromebook, step-by-step:

  1. Click on the Launcher at the bottom-left of your screen, or hit the “Finder” key on your keyboard. It looks like a magnifying glass or “search” button.
  2. Find the Play Store and launch the app.
  3. In the Play Store, search for “amino social network” and find the official app. Or you can just click here to go there directly.
  4. Download and install Amino.
  5. After it’s done downloading, click on the Launcher once again. You should see “Amino” show up on the list of installed apps.
  6. Click on it to run it.
  7. Sign in with your account or register a new one.

That’s it!

Please note that only newer models can actually run Android apps directly. If you see a message that says “You have no devices” or something similar, it means either your Chromebook model doesn’t have the capability to download Play Store apps.

If you’re using different computers to install apps, you need to be using the same Google Account to download them.

Use the web version of Amino

Website version of Amino.
Amino also has a web-based version online that works on Chromebooks.

You can log on to the web-based version of Amino if you don’t want to download the app. There used to be no web-based version, but a while back the developers created one.

So now Amino has a website that you can logon to and chat with others in your communities.

You can access their site from any device that has a modern web browser (iPad, Android, iPhone, PC, Mac, Linux, etc.) and sign in to your account online.

The Amino site is https://aminoapps.com/.

From there, just click the “Sign in” option at the right and you can access all your communities and chat!

How do you send messages with Amino?

You can start a chat by clicking on one of your Community subscriptions on the side menu.

Just click on the Community of your choice, then click “Create” to start a public or private chat. Amino is already really easy to use, but if you have questions, you should check out their support page.

You can privately chat with any user within the group.

Sending messages through Amino on a Chromebook is no different than the phone app. The layout just changes a bit. You can create a message by clicking Community > Create > Private Chat. This will let you compile a message to a specific user in private. You can also send a public chat which will be seen by everyone.

How do you leave a chat on Amino?

Just click on the options menu and then hit “Leave Conversation” to exit the chat.
